  • “An important aspect of my identity as an artist comes from my experience as a working class laborer. My work in construction and in commerical art utilized grids as functional layout tools, but as I incorporated them into my work my use of grids evolved to reflect a deeper meaning to me. The grid symbolizes modernity, and the myth of progress through capitalist enterprise that inherently commodifies and dehumanizes human labor.”
    —Jaime Muñoz
